The 10 happiest countries:
1. Norway
2. Denmark
3. Iceland
4. Switzerland
5. Finland
6. The Netherlands
7. Canada
8. New Zealand
9. Australia
10. Sweden
While Australia stayed relatively stable, the United States slipped from 13th to 14th place.
n Western countries such as Australia, mental illness turned out to be the most important determinant of happiness – above income, employment or physical wellbeing.
“In [the United States, Australia, Britain, and Indonesia] the most powerful effect would come from the elimination of depression and anxiety disorders, which are the main form of mental illness,” authors wrote.
